The Allen-Bradley 1746-NO4I is a high-resolution, 4-channel analog output module engineered for the SLC 500 programmable logic controller system. This module provides four independent current output channels, specifically designed for industrial control applications requiring precise current signals between 0 and 20 mA.
| Model | 1746-NO4I |
| Channels | 4 Current Output |
| Output Range | 0 to 20 mA |
| Resolution | 14-bit |
| Backplane Current (5V DC) | 55 mA |
| Backplane Current (24V DC) | 195 mA |
| Operating Temperature | 0 to 60 degC |
| Storage Temperature | -40 to 85 degC |
| Isolation Rating | 500V DC (Field to Backplane) |
The 1746-NO4I is widely utilized in process automation environments, including water treatment facilities for valve and pump control, chemical processing for PID-based pressure and temperature regulation, and HVAC systems for damper positioning. Its high-resolution output makes it suitable for driving VFDs and other current-controlled field devices.
This module serves as an analog output interface for the SLC 500 series, converting digital data from the processor into four independent 0-20 mA current signals for field instrumentation.
The 1746-NO4I provides galvanic isolation between the field wiring and the backplane, rated up to 500V DC.
The output circuits are designed to support a load resistance range of 0 to 500 ohms.
